Court convicts former officers of closed Rural Bank of Buguias (Benguet) Inc.

THE Regional Trial Court of La Trinidad, Benguet has convicted former officers of the closed Rural Bank of Buguias (Benguet) Inc. (RB Buguias) for violating the Bangko Sentral ng Pilipinas’ (BSP) Manual of Regulations for Banks and The General Banking Law of 2000 in relation to The New Central Bank Act.

The criminal cases arose when accused former RB Buguias managers Bryan Depalog and Lorna Lidua, together with cashier and teller Virginia Palbusa, were found to have participated in granting irregular and questionable loans to the bank’s own directors, officers, stockholders, and their related interests.

Based on the complaint filed by the BSP, the court found all the accused guilty beyond reasonable doubt of violations of the provisions of the law pertaining to loans granted to DOSRI and participation in fraudulent transactions.

The court sentenced Depalog, Lidua and Palbusa to pay P100,000, P300,000, and P150,000 in fines, respectively. (PR)
